Senior Software Engineer – Ad Monetization
Zynga · Toronto
Job description
About the role
The Senior Software Engineer on Zynga’s Ad Monetization team creates interactive advertising experiences such as mini‑games and surveys. You will transform approved creative concepts into polished, high‑performing ad units and own the technical execution from implementation through deployment.
Key responsibilities
- Build high‑quality playable ads and interactive creative units from storyboards, design assets, and briefs.
- Implement gameplay mechanics, transitions, animations, and other UX elements for seamless user experiences.
- Integrate and optimize creative assets across supported environments, ensuring performance, responsiveness, and file‑size efficiency.
- Implement tracking, analytics, and event instrumentation to measure creative performance.
- Conduct self‑QA, resolve issues, and deliver production‑ready builds with minimal oversight.
Required profile
-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science or a related technical discipline (or equivalent).
- 6+ years of professional software development experience.
Required skills
- Proficiency with HTML5, CSS3, and modern JavaScript (ES6+).
- Experience with 2D HTML5 game frameworks such as Phaser or CreateJS.
- Knowledge of 2D/3D JavaScript frameworks like PixiJS and ThreeJS.
- Strong understanding of coordinate systems, geometry, vector math, and pixel‑level manipulation (ImageData).
- Hands‑on experience with the HTML5 Canvas API, render loops, requestAnimationFrame, and animation timing.
- Responsive Web Design expertise and building fluid layouts for mobile, tablet, and desktop.
- Asset‑management pipelines for efficient loading, caching, and optimization of spritesheets, audio sprites, and JSON data.
- Proficiency with Photoshop is highly preferred.
